The Power of Robotic Process Automation (RPA): Benefits and Applications
The Power of Robotic Process Automation (RPA): Benefits and Applications
Robotic Process Automation (RPA) is a technology that allows businesses to automate repetitive and time-consuming tasks, leading to significant improvements in efficiency and cost savings. By utilizing software robots that emulate human actions, RPA enables organizations to streamline processes, enhance accuracy, and achieve consistency. This article delves into the various benefits of RPA and its practical applications in different industries.
Understanding Robotic Process Automation (RPA)
Robotic Process Automation is a form of business automation that uses software technologies to automate workflows. It involves the use of artificial intelligence and machine learning algorithms to mimic human behavior in performing routine tasks. RPA is particularly effective in automating back-office processes that are rule-based and can be repetitive in nature.
Benefits of Robotic Process Automation (RPA)
Robotic Process Automation offers numerous benefits to businesses. These include:
Improved Efficiency: RPA allows for the automation of repetitive and time-consuming tasks, freeing up employees to focus on more strategic and value-adding activities. This leads to increased productivity and better utilization of human resources. Enhanced Accuracy: RPA minimizes human errors, resulting in higher accuracy and consistency in task execution. This is crucial for maintaining the integrity of business operations and ensuring compliance with regulatory requirements. Cost Savings: RPA optimizes resources by automating processes, reducing the need for significant investments in new infrastructure. This leads to cost-efficient operations and better decision-making. Scalability: RPA can easily scale to handle increased workloads without the need for additional investments in hardware or software. This provides businesses with greater flexibility and adaptability to meet changing business demands. Incredible Cost Savings: Compared to human labor, RPA can significantly reduce operational costs. Tasks that would otherwise require a human workforce can be accomplished for a fraction of the cost. RPA robots can work tirelessly, 24/7, after initial implementation and training.Applications of Robotic Process Automation (RPA)
RPA can be applied in a wide range of tasks, including:
Data Entry: Extracting, validating, and inputting data across different systems. Transaction Processing: Handling and processing financial transactions. Report Generation: Compiling data and generating reports. Email Automation: Managing and responding to emails based on predefined rules. System Integration: Connecting disparate systems and facilitating data flow between them.Quickly automate repetitive tasks: RPA's software “robot” replicates routine actions to automate tedious repetitive tasks. For example, extracting data from an invoice can be a labor-intensive task. Once trained, RPA bots can effectively perform this task with high accuracy.
